Snatched Up to Heaven for Kids is a children's book that tells the story of Emma, a young girl who has a dream about heaven. In her dream, she meets angels, Jesus, and other people who have died. She learns about the beauty of heaven and the joy that awaits those who live a good life.
The book is written in a simple and easy-to-understand way that is perfect for young children. The illustrations are colorful and engaging, and they help to bring the story to life.
Snatched Up to Heaven for Kids is a great book for parents who want to teach their children about heaven. It is also a good book for children who are curious about death and the afterlife.

Here is a more detailed review of the book:
Plot: The plot of Snatched Up to Heaven for Kids is simple but effective. Emma has a dream about heaven, and in her dream, she learns about the beauty and joy that awaits those who live a good life. She meets angels, Jesus, and other people who have died. The dream is a positive and uplifting experience for Emma, and it helps her to understand the meaning of life and death.
Characters: The characters in Snatched Up to Heaven for Kids are well-developed and relatable. Emma is a likable protagonist, and the other characters, such as the angels and Jesus, are also well-characterized. The characters help to bring the story to life and make it more engaging for young readers.
Setting: The setting of Snatched Up to Heaven for Kids is heaven. The book does not provide a detailed description of heaven, but it does emphasize the beauty, joy, and peace of the place. The setting helps to create a sense of wonder and awe in young readers.
Theme: The theme of Snatched Up to Heaven for Kids is the importance of living a good life. The book teaches children that if they live a good life, they will inherit eternal life in heaven. This message is positive and uplifting, and it can help children to understand the importance of making good choices in life.
Illustrations: The illustrations in Snatched Up to Heaven for Kids are colorful and engaging. They help to bring the story to life and make it more appealing to young readers. The illustrations are also a good way to help children visualize heaven.
